View Full Version : Rocky Patel Vintage 1990 Torpedo Cigar Review Video

This 6.25 by 52 maduro stick offers a virtually seamless satin wrapper with some small veins showing in darkened color only. Overall a dark chocolate color it gives off a rich oily slightly sweet tobacco aroma. First light reveals a full palate of complex flavors, requiring multiple draws to fully experience. They included deep earth, sweetness, smooth tobacco, nuts, slight pepper, cocoa, coffee and cream. The first third develops to a solid medium body, with tons of very smooth rich smoke output and a very easy draw. Flavors remain complex and very creamy in texture. By the 2nd third flavors had become more of the creamy cocoa, with undertones of a caramel and a deep oily finish. Ending at the 1:10 min mark, the stick proved to be the same flavor wise through the remainder, which was just fine with me! http://cigarobsession.com/cigar-reviews/rocky-patel-vintage-1990-torpedo-cigar-review/
